安全验证滑动页面一起跑了怎么办?解决方案全解析!安全验证滑动页面一起跑了怎么办
本文目录导读:
在移动应用开发中,滑动页面是一个非常常见的交互设计方式,能够提升用户体验,让操作更加直观,在实际开发过程中,滑动页面往往会遇到安全验证的问题,导致用户在滑动页面时无法完成验证步骤,页面出现“一起跑了”的现象,这种情况下,用户可能会感到困惑,甚至放弃使用应用,如何解决滑动页面与安全验证之间的冲突,是一个需要认真思考的问题。
问题分析
-
滑动页面与安全验证的冲突 滑动页面是一种直观的交互方式,用户通过滑动屏幕来完成某个操作,安全验证通常需要用户输入密码、填写验证码或进行其他交互操作,这与滑动页面的操作逻辑存在冲突,当用户试图滑动页面时,系统可能会因为安全验证的需要而无法完成滑动操作,导致页面“一起跑了”。
-
用户体验的影响 滑动页面是用户使用应用时的主要操作方式之一,如果滑动页面因安全验证问题而无法使用,用户可能会感到不满,甚至流失,解决这个问题对提升用户体验至关重要。
-
技术实现的难点 在技术实现上,滑动页面和安全验证需要协调一致,如果验证逻辑设计不当,或者页面布局不合理,都可能导致滑动页面无法完成验证步骤。
解决方案
-
优化滑动页面的逻辑 在设计滑动页面时,需要考虑安全验证的逻辑,验证步骤应该在用户滑动页面之前完成,或者验证结果应该不影响滑动操作,如果验证步骤在滑动操作之后,用户在滑动页面时可能会因为验证失败而无法完成滑动。
-
调整页面布局 滑动页面的设计需要考虑页面的布局和元素的排列,如果滑动区域的布局不合理,可能会导致用户在滑动时无法到达验证步骤,或者验证步骤的位置不明显,影响用户的操作体验。
-
使用滑动验证的缓存机制 有些应用在滑动页面时,会使用滑动验证的缓存机制,这样即使用户滑动页面多次,验证结果也会保持一致,如果缓存机制设计不当,可能会导致滑动页面因验证失败而无法完成。
-
设计友好的提示信息 在滑动页面时,如果因为安全验证问题导致页面无法滑动,应该及时向用户提示问题,可以向用户显示“滑动页面时请先完成验证”之类的提示信息,帮助用户理解问题所在。
-
测试和迭代 在设计滑动页面和安全验证逻辑时,需要进行充分的测试,通过用户测试和数据分析,了解用户在滑动页面时遇到的问题,及时调整设计和逻辑,提升用户体验。
具体实施步骤
-
分析现有页面和验证逻辑 需要对当前的滑动页面和安全验证逻辑进行全面的分析,了解页面的布局、元素的排列,以及验证步骤的顺序和内容,如果发现验证步骤在滑动操作之后,或者验证逻辑与页面布局不一致,需要及时调整。
-
优化滑动页面的逻辑 根据分析结果,优化滑动页面的逻辑,将验证步骤移到滑动操作之前,或者将验证结果与滑动操作分离,这样可以避免因验证问题导致滑动失败。
-
调整页面布局 根据优化后的逻辑,调整页面布局,将验证步骤放在滑动区域的最前面,或者将验证结果以弹窗的形式展示,而不是在滑动过程中触发,这样可以避免用户在滑动时因验证问题而无法完成操作。
-
测试和调整 在优化和调整页面布局后,需要进行全面的测试,通过用户测试,了解用户在滑动页面时遇到的问题,及时调整设计和逻辑,还需要进行性能测试,确保滑动页面和验证逻辑的效率。
-
部署与迭代 部署优化后的页面和验证逻辑到生产环境,并持续监测用户反馈,根据反馈结果,进行进一步的优化和迭代,不断提升用户体验。
注意事项
-
避免过度依赖缓存机制 在使用滑动验证的缓存机制时,需要避免过度依赖缓存,如果缓存机制设计不当,可能会导致滑动页面因验证失败而无法完成,需要定期检查和更新缓存机制。
-
设计清晰的提示信息 在滑动页面时,如果因为安全验证问题导致页面无法滑动,应该及时向用户提示问题,可以向用户显示“滑动页面时请先完成验证”之类的提示信息,帮助用户理解问题所在。
-
考虑用户隐私 在设计滑动页面和安全验证逻辑时,需要考虑用户隐私,验证步骤不应该涉及用户敏感信息,或者需要得到用户的明确授权,如果验证步骤涉及用户隐私,需要严格遵守相关法律法规。
-
持续监测和优化 在部署优化后的页面和验证逻辑后,需要持续监测用户行为和反馈,了解用户在滑动页面时遇到的问题,根据反馈结果,及时调整设计和逻辑,不断提升用户体验。
滑动页面和安全验证的冲突是一个需要认真解决的问题,通过优化滑动页面的逻辑、调整页面布局、使用滑动验证的缓存机制、设计友好的提示信息以及持续监测和优化,可以有效解决滑动页面与安全验证冲突的问题,最终的目标是提升用户体验,让滑动页面成为用户使用应用的首选方式。
安全验证滑动页面一起跑了怎么办?解决方案全解析!安全验证滑动页面一起跑了怎么办,
发表评论